Create and manage expense entries
- Confirm the active company.
- Open Expenses and choose Add expense.
- Select the client and project. Both are required.
- Enter the expense date and an amount greater than zero.
- Select Reimbursable if the company or client should repay the person or entity that incurred the cost.
- Add a description that explains the business purpose.
- Save the expense.
The project controls which company's books and client engagement the expense belongs to. If a client or project is missing, verify the active company, project status, and your access to the project.
Edit an expenseOpen the row menu and choose Edit expense entry. Update the client, project, date, amount, reimbursable setting, or description, then save.
An expense that has already been submitted or approved may not be editable. Use the actions offered for that row; TimeSentry calculates available actions from the expense's status and your company context.
Understand common actions- Submit sends a ready-to-bill expense for review.
- Recall pulls back a submitted expense before approval.
- Approve accepts an expense that needs your company's review.
- Reject returns it for correction.
- Archive removes an expense from normal working views without immediately deleting it.
- Unarchive returns an archived expense to active views.
- Delete permanently removes an expense when that action is available.
Use bulk actions only after reviewing the selected rows. Available bulk actions depend on what every selected expense is allowed to do.
